Ecotourism in Turkey:
Embracing sustainable practices, Turkey has become a hub for ecotourism, offering travelers unique experiences in harmony with nature. One remarkable example is the Köprülü Canyon National Park, located in the Antalya province. This ecotourism hotspot allows visitors to explore its diverse flora and fauna while adhering to strict regulations aimed at protecting its delicate ecosystem. By implementing controlled visitor access and promoting educational initiatives, Köprülü Canyon sets a commendable standard for ecological conservation in Turkey.
Sustainable Practices in Cappadocia:
Cappadocia, known for its otherworldly landscapes and fairy-tale-like rock formations, has established itself as a pioneer in sustainable tourism. With a strong emphasis on environmental responsibility, the region has implemented innovative waste management systems and recycling initiatives. By employing eco-friendly materials and minimizing its environmental footprint, Cappadocia ensures the preservation of its natural wonders while attracting environmentally conscious tourists from around the globe.
Preserving Marine Biodiversity in Kaş:
Nestled along the Turquoise Coast, the coastal town of Kaş has emerged as a haven for underwater enthusiasts. Recognizing the significance of its vibrant marine ecosystem, Kaş has implemented stringent regulations on diving activities to protect its underwater treasures. The town actively collaborates with local dive operators and engages in coral reef restoration projects, offering visitors an unforgettable and environmentally responsible diving experience.
National Efforts and Partnerships:
Turkey's commitment to sustainable nature tourism extends beyond individual destinations. The Turkish Ministry of Culture and Tourism actively supports projects that enhance environmental awareness and safeguard the country's natural heritage. Through partnerships with local communities, governmental organizations, and NGOs, Turkey strives to strike a harmonious balance between tourism development and nature conservation.
